HENRI DESHARNAIS 1928 - 2001 On November 20, 2001, after a short battle with cancer, Henri died peacefully at his residence, surrounded by his family. Left to cherish is memory are his beloved wife Gertrude and son Robert; his eight children, Monique (Ron), Claudette (Doug), Helene (Rene), Suzanne (Doug), Daniel (Louise), Rachel (Maurice), Alain, Luc (Shirley) 16 grandchildren and three great-grandchildren. He also leaves behind his dear mother Elise; one brother Armand (Claire) two sisters, Soeur Irene (pssf) and Soeur Amanda (snjm). He was predeceased by his father Ovila and one sister Soeur Lucille (pmsj). In 1949, he wed Lucille (Sabourin) and together they enjoyed their children and the farm life - first in dairy farming and later in grain farming. From 1974 to 1983, he was councillor for his ward in the RM of DeSalaberry. He later sold the farm and eventually moved to Winnipeg. His "retirement" brought new adventures: from his employment at the Delta Hotel...to bringing new life to furniture...to spending countless volunteer hours at the Foyer Valade. Henri constantly showed his love and pride for French culture and heritage: Follies Grenouilles, Cabane a Sucre, Festival de Voyageur, Crow Wing Trail, Maison Moise Goulet, lindification des Fondateurs de lAssociation dEducation des Canadiens Francais du Manitoba. Those who were fortunate to know Henri were struck by his humour, honesty, integrity, fairness, magnetism, joie de vivre, free spirit and creativity. He always forged ahead with courage and conviction. His openness, thirst for knowledge, love of communication and nature made him a truly exceptional man. He instilled the importance of close family ties in his children. He was prepared for lifes final steps and had an acceptance for the joys still to come. In Henris words "I am not going anywhere when I die, no. I am already there. All I have to do is shed my old clothes to live - more freely and more perfectly the God-given beauty of life that He only can want for me." Cremation has taken place.
